FIELD: acoustics.
SUBSTANCE: invention relates to noise suppression. Silencer comprises a cylindrical housing, rigidly connected with end inlet and outlet nozzles, sound absorber located between cylindrical housing and perforated element, and an acoustically transparent material, placed between perforated element and sound absorber, wherein sound absorber is made of mineral wool on basalt base of “Rockwool” type, or “URSA” mineral wool, basalt wool P-75, or glass wool with glass felt, or foamed polymer, for example, polyethylene or polypropylene, wherein sound absorbing element over its entire surface is lined with acoustically transparent material, for example, glass fabric EZ-100 or polymer of “Poviden” type.
EFFECT: higher efficiency of noise suppression.
